PAYDAY
A brand that began focusing on workwear in the 1920s. Its iconic coveralls and engineer jackets are beloved not only by fans of vintage American workwear but also in the modern fashion scene.

Vintage-inspired details
The collarless design was originally made for engineers to work more easily, offering simple yet functional beauty.
The antique-style tuck buttons feature the PAYDAY stamp, adding a vintage touch to the jacket.
The sleeves are designed with raglan sleeves for better mobility and comfort. The left chest and waist feature home base-shaped pockets, and the right pocket includes a union ticket inside.
